The Frog is a 2024 South Korean mystery crime thriller series written by Son Ho Young and directed by Mo Wan Il.
The series was released on Netflix on August 23, 2024 and has 8 episodes.

During the summer in the present day, Jeon Yeong Ha runs a vacation cottage located deep in the woods. His peaceful life is shaken by the sudden appearance of a mysterious woman named Yoo Seong A.
In the early 2000's, Koo Sang Jun ran the same vacation cottage as Jeon Yeong Ha did years later. Koo Sang Jun and his family also lived there, but during the summer, something happened at his vacation cottage and Koo Sang Jun lost everything because of that. At the time Yoon Bo Min, worked as a police officer at the nearest police sub station from the vacation cottage.
20 years later, Yoon Bo Min is transferred to the same police sub station where she worked before and she begins to work there as the chief. She enjoys solving things and begins to observe Jeon Yeong Ha closely.

Don't Fight the Feeling is EXO's 7th mini album, it's also Xiumin and D.O.'s first release since completing their military service. As well as Xiumin and D.O.'s return it also marks the first appearance from Lay on a whole EXO album since the release of their 5th mini album For Life back in 2016.

On the 8th of April 2021, on their 9th anniversary as a group, EXO uploaded a video, with members Xiumin, Chanyeol, Baekhyun, D.O., Kai and Sehun, where they talked about their anniversary and also revealed that they had been preparing for their next release.
The next month, on the 10th of May 2021, it was announced that EXO would be releasing a special album, titled Don't Stop the Feeling.

Prior to the albums release, it received 1.2 million pre-orders within a 27-day period, breaking their previous personal record of 1.1 million with Don't Mess Up My Tempo.
On the 14th of June 2021, just 8 days after the albums release, the album was announced to have sold over 1 million copies, this is the groups 6th album to have crossed the 1 million sales mark.

Don't Fight the Feeling won EXO 1 music show trophy, taking 1st place on Music Bank.

Don't Figh the Feeling peaked at No.1 on the Gaon Albums Chart, No.3 on the Oricon Albums Chart, No.57 on the Official UK Download Albums Chart and No.8 on the Billboard World Albums Chart.
Gaon Sales = 1,300,337+
Oricon Sales = 46,966+
Chinese Sales = 484,117+
Giving the album so far a total of 1,831,420+ in physical sales.

Don't Fight the Feeling was released in 4 versions: 2 photo book versions, a jewel case version and an expansion ver.
The photo book versions are set out in a paperback book style case, with the photo book version 1 coming with the Cd, photo book, lyrics book, planet card set, a random postcard and a random photo card. The photo book version 2 comes with the Cd, photo book, lyrics book, envelope, 2 random folded posters, 2 random postcards and a random photo card.
The jewel case version is set out in a normal Cd jewel case and comes with the Cd, booklet, lyrics paper, random AR clip card and a random AR photo card.
The expansion version is available with 6 member covers and like the photo book versions is set out in a paperback book style case and comes with the Cd, member specific photo book, 2 stickers, member specific ID card and a random photo card.
